I have updated my firmware to 1.40, installed dji go app, updated the controller, set up multiple flight modes yet when i switch the atti toggle to F I do not see the app appear on my screen ????????? any ideas or suggestions as to why ???? would be greatly appreciated............i am using a phantom 3 advanced by the way
 
Did you try doing that after taking off?
 
It wont bring up the modes unless the P3 is flying.
 
no i haven't tried taking off . I was worried there might be some kind of problem which would bring my drone down.....do you suggest I try to fly then toggle over to F atti while in flight ??
That is the only way the Intelligent Control controls work in the app, you have to be flying.

Turn on the controller, load the app-- turn on the P3-- Does the app connect to the aircraft.

If it does and and you get the green status bar in the app-- take off-- fly out about 100 feet and up about 50 ft. Switch the mode switch to F and the IOC screen should pop up.
 
possibly i was not flying high enough....i was just hovering ten feet off the ground....i will try that....will this also increase the camera resolution ?.........i have an advanced model......I really appreciate your help !!
 
You can't "increase the camera resolution".

However, in the app, you can select from the available resolutions in the Camera Menu settings.
